Fiber Splitter Box

An Optical Fiber Splitter Box is an essential component in fiber-optic networks, enabling the distribution of optical signals from a single input to multiple outputs. This functionality is crucial in Passive Optical Networks (PONs), where a single optical line terminal (OLT) at the service provider's central office connects to multiple optical network units (ONUs) at end-user locations. EN.WIKIPEDIA.ORG Key Features: Low Insertion Loss: Ensures minimal signal loss during transmission, maintaining the integrity of the optical signal. High Return Loss: Reduces signal reflection, which is vital for maintaining signal quality and preventing interference. Wide Wavelength Range: Supports a broad spectrum of wavelengths, enhancing compatibility with various transmission protocols. Excellent Channel-to-Channel Uniformity: Ensures consistent signal distribution across all output channels, maintaining uniform performance.

FIBER OPTIC CABLE

A 24-fiber Multi Loose Tube (MLT) Armored Optical Fiber Cable with 6 tubes is designed to house 24 optical fibers distributed across six loose tubes, each containing four fibers. The armored construction provides enhanced mechanical protection, making it suitable for installations in environments where additional durability is required. Key Features: Fiber Count: 24 optical fibers. Loose Tubes: 6 tubes, each housing 4 fibers. Strength Member: Typically incorporates a central strength member, such as Glass Reinforced Plastic (GRP), to provide tensile strength and maintain cable integrity during installation and operation. Armoring: Features materials like corrugated steel tape (CST) or aluminum tape to protect the fibers from mechanical stresses and potential damage. Water Blocking: Utilizes water-blocking materials, such as water-swellable yarns and tapes, to prevent moisture ingress. Jacket Material: Often made of Low Smoke Zero Halogen (LSZH) materials, ensuring durability and safety in various environments. Applications: Suitable for direct burial, duct, and aerial installations, especially in environments where additional mechanical protection is necessary.

PLC SPLITTER

Definition: The SBINT PLC Splitter Without Connector is a high-quality fiber optic splitter designed to distribute optical signals from a single fiber input to multiple outputs. It is based on Planar Lightwave Circuit (PLC) technology, ensuring low insertion loss, high reliability, and uniform signal distribution. This splitter is ideal for FTTH, PON, CATV, and telecom networks, where efficient optical signal splitting is required. Key Features: High-Precision PLC Technology – Ensures stable and even optical signal distribution with minimal loss. Wide Operating Wavelength – Supports 1260nm to 1650nm, making it compatible with various fiber optic applications. Compact & Lightweight Design – Easy to install in fiber distribution boxes and network enclosures. High Durability & Reliability – Built to withstand harsh environmental conditions for long-term performance. Multiple Output Configurations – Available in 1x2, 1x4, 1x8, 1x16, 1x32, and 1x64 configurations to suit different network requirements.
